WebIf you have several plants, plant them at least a foot and a half apart, "facing" the same way. Japanese Iris prefer bright, sunny locations but can live in partial shade. They require high soil moisture and a fair amount of feeding throughout their growth period. Space plants 2 feet or more apart in heavy soil, amended with compost and peat ... Nitrogen is vital for healthy growing, but too much can cause soft, disease-prone growth.
